Join London Concertante for a candlelit piano recital performed by Gunel Mirzayeva, featuring a wide-ranging programme that moves from the Baroque to the early 20th century.
The evening includes Chopin’s lyrical Nocturnes, Mozart’s elegant Sonata in A major, K.331, and Debussy’s atmospheric Arabesques and Clair de lune. Earlier music is represented by Rameau’s Pièces de clavecin and Bach’s Aria from the Goldberg Variations, presented here with improvisations that bring a fresh perspective to a familiar work.
The concert concludes with Beethoven’s Piano Sonata No. 14 in C-sharp minor - the “Moonlight” Sonata - one of the most recognisable and enduring works in the piano repertoire.
